IN BRIEF: Seplat says orders against Orjiako do not impact operations

10th Aug 2023 18:17

Seplat Energy PLC - Lagos-based oil and gas firm - Says that on August 8, it was served ex parte interim court orders, which were granted by the Federal High Court sitting in Lagos, Nigeria. These orders were part of a bankruptcy court action instituted by Access Bank PLC against Dr Orjiako, for the recovery of an outstanding loan amount that forms the judgment delivered by the High Court of the United Kingdom and registered in Nigeria as a judgment of the Federal High Court. IN BRIEF: Seplat CEO's Nigerian immigration documents restored

13th Jun 2023 13:36

Seplat Energy PLC - Lagos-based oil and gas firm with assets in Nigeria - Says the Nigerian Ministry of Interior & Immigration Service has restored Chief Executive Officer Roger Brown's working permit and key visas. Brown's immigration documents had been withdrawn by the ministry in March following allegations of "racism, discrimination and improper immigration status" by some Seplat workers and stakeholders. Says it has "cooperated fully" with the verification checks conducted by the immigration authorities. A lawsuit was filed on April 13 at the Federal High Court in Abuja against the company in relation to Brown's immigration status, but was withdrawn on April 20. Read More

IN BRIEF: Seplat Energy extends Mobil Producing Nigeria purchase deal

24th May 2023 10:41

Seplat Energy PLC - Lagos-based oil and gas firm with assets in Nigeria - Extends agreement to acquire Mobil Producing Nigeria Inc amid pending the resolution of legal proceedings and receipt of regulatory approvals, but "remains committed" to completing the acquisition. Says agreement has been revised so that in the event the transaction closes, Exxon Mobil Corp will share in a portion of the value of Mobil Producing Nigeria during the period of delay. The exact amount of this value will depend on "a number of factors", including the amount of oil produced and oil prices. Read More

IN BRIEF: Seplat Energy to defend action against company officials

11th May 2023 19:42

Seplat Energy PLC - oil and gas firm with assets in Nigeria - Notes reports that the Federal High Court sitting in Abuja has granted interim orders against the company and some of its officers. Points out the interim orders - which are yet to be served - primarily restrain the chair, named independent non-executive directors, chief operating officer and company secretary from operating or functioning as officers of Seplat Energy in any capacity. IN BRIEF: Seplat Energy notes Lagos court reversal on chief executive

6th Apr 2023 14:15

Seplat Energy PLC - Lagos-based oil and gas company focused on Nigeria - Says High Court in Lagos, Nigeria vacates interim court order against Chief Executive Officer Roger Brown. The case has been adjourned to May 16 to continue hearing, allowing Brown to run the company again. In March, Seplat reported Brown had been barred from running the company for seven days, amid accusations of racism. Says the company maintains the petition filed by 5 persons claiming to be minority shareholders "lacks proper basis" and is premised on false allegations. Says it remains confident that the judicial process will address the circumstances appropriately and continues to engage the Nigerian interior ministry. Read More

IN BRIEF: Seplat posts improved performance thanks to higher oil price

27th Oct 2022 12:02

Seplat Energy PLC - Lagos-based oil and gas company focused on Nigeria - In the nine months to September 30, says revenue rises 34% year-on-year to USD618.6 million from USD460.4 million. Pretax profit leaps 90% to USD185.2 million from USD97.4 million. Volumes lifted falls 11% to 4.9 million barrels of oil/gas from 5.5 million, but the average realised oil price rises 61% to USD108.25. Average realised gas price dips 2.1% to USD2.80. Declares quarterly dividend of 2.5 cents, unchanged from a year before, and brings total for the year-to-date to 7.5 cents. Read More

IN BRIEF: Seplat gets ministerial approval for Exxon Mobil deal

8th Aug 2022 17:57

Seplat Energy PLC - Lagos-based oil and gas company focused on Nigeria - Receives letter from minister of state for petroleum resources that Muhammadu Buhari, president of Nigeria, has approved that ministerial consent be granted to Seplat Energy Offshore Ltd's USD1.28 billion acquisition of Mobil Producing Nigeria Unlimited from Exxon Mobil Corp.
